Music Update

by Mr Thomas Williams, Instrumental Music Coordinator

This year has seen the Music Department continue to grow and thrive, with performances at VSMF, the Royal South Street Eisteddfod, as well as on-site and off-site performances with our ensembles. One highlight from this year has been the jazz night, celebrating the 95th Anniversary of the school. It was inspiring to see the combination of past and current students, and staff all play together. What was so wonderful to see was the combination of the generations of people involved with Box Hill High School’s Music Department all coming together to make wonderful music. 

 

We have also seen our Units 3 & 4 class finish up the year with their final recitals, and farewell our Year 12s in our ensembles. We hope that they continue to play music throughout their lives, and remember to keep making music in their communities. 

 

Looking towards 2026, we are looking forward to seeing continued growth with our current ensembles, welcoming a new junior concert band, as well as trialling chamber music for more experienced musicians in our department.
